Manually extract files from armhf pacakge and copy it * What was the outcome of this action? I cannot install amd64 and armhf version together. It's a problem for cross-compilation with clang because you cannot link against compiler-rt. For example I have issue with m4 (libm4), m4 can be compiled with gcc and linked against libgcc, also it can be compiled with clang and linked against compiler-rt, but it cannot be compiled with clang and linked against libgcc. It leads to: /usr/bin/arm-linux-gnueabihf-ld: symtab.o: in function `symtab_init': symtab.c:(.text+0x34): undefined reference to `__mulodi4' /usr/bin/arm-linux-gnueabihf-ld: ../lib/libm4.a(clean-temp.o): in function `create_temp_dir': clean-temp.c:(.text+0x9c): undefined reference to `__mulodi4' /usr/bin/arm-linux-gnueabihf-ld: ../lib/libm4.a(fatal-signal.o): in function `at_fatal_signal': fatal-signal.c:(.text+0x190): undefined reference to `__mulodi4' /usr/bin/arm-linux-gnueabihf-ld: ../lib/libm4.a(xmalloc.o): in function `xnmalloc': xmalloc.c:(.text+0x30): undefined reference to `__mulodi4' /usr/bin/arm-linux-gnueabihf-ld: ../lib/libm4.a(xmalloc.o): in function `xnrealloc': xmalloc.c:(.text+0xe4): undefined reference to `__mulodi4' /usr/bin/arm-linux-gnueabihf-ld: ../lib/libm4.a(xmalloc.o):xmalloc.c:(.text+0x334): more undefined references to `__mulodi4' follow Briefly speaking it leads to missing /usr/lib/llvm-11/lib/clang/11.0.1/lib/linux/libclang_rt.builtins-armhf.a * What outcome did you expect instead?
